About this farm
Liepold Pond Farm is a small vegetable and cut flower farm at 136 Liberty Street in Pawcatuck, Connecticut. The owner-submitted listing describes a seasonal farm stand open June through October, with specialty produce and flowers. Connecticut Veteran Grown notes that Jacques Dufresne and Jody Ward grow dozens of seasonal vegetables, including eggplants, tomatoes, artichokes, leeks, and fennel, along with an expanding cut flower program. Certified Naturally Grown lists the farm for produce and flowers, with vegetables, herbs, berries, tree fruit, and flowers grown for market stands and restaurants.
